How can incorporating empathy and active listening into cross-cultural communication lead to the development of more inclusive and diverse perspectives within a globalized society?
Incorporating empathy and active listening into cross-cultural communication can help individuals better understand and appreciate different perspectives, leading to increased tolerance and acceptance of diverse viewpoints. By actively listening and empathizing with others, individuals can build trust and rapport across cultural boundaries, fostering a more inclusive and respectful environment. This can ultimately lead to the development of more diverse perspectives within a globalized society, as people are more willing to engage with and learn from individuals with different backgrounds and experiences.
